The Prayagraj branch of Bharat Sevashram Sangha: A Centre of Devotion and Service


This revered ashram in Prayagraj stands as one of the most respected institutions committed to serving humanity through spirituality and compassion. Rooted in the ideals of Swami Pranavananda Maharaj, it continues to guide people toward selfless living and higher values. Situated in the holy land of Prayagraj, it serves as a haven for pilgrims and spiritual aspirants, combining meditation, devotion, and humanitarian outreach.
Through its inclusive approach to service and devotion, it symbolises the Indian tradition of kindness and unity, upholding the sacred principle that service to humanity is worship of God.

Religious Practices and Spiritual Programmes


Devotional gatherings, discourses, and meditation sessions are conducted regularly that nurture inner peace and moral strength. Visitors often join the monks for morning and evening prayers led by monks and spiritual teachers. During major events such as the Magh Mela and Kumbh Mela, the organisation offers hospitality and religious guidance to countless visitors.
The calm atmosphere nurtures reflection, prayer, and understanding of Swami Pranavananda’s philosophy — whose mission was to unite humanity through selfless service and moral strength.

Service and Social Outreach


Apart from spiritual activities, the Sangha is equally active in social welfare and relief work. It organises numerous welfare drives, from education to disaster relief. Initiatives include free education, food distribution, and medical treatment for the needy.
During times of natural calamities, the Sangha’s volunteers are among the first to reach affected areas, extending relief materials and emotional support. Such dedicated service has made the Sangha a symbol of faith and humanity

Facilities for Devotees and Visitors


For devotees visiting Prayagraj, especially during religious gatherings, the ashram offers simple yet Bharat Sevashram Sangha comfortable accommodation. Clean surroundings and caring staff create a welcoming environment. Many visitors appreciate the spiritual ambience and the hospitality extended by the monks and volunteers.
Visitors can access vegetarian dining, prayer areas, and ritual guidance at the ashram near the revered meeting point of the Ganga, Yamuna, and Saraswati.
